Kerala polls: Tourism revival takes centre stage in Wayanad electoral battle
Summary
Wayanad, known for its natural beauty, faces significant challenges due to frequent natural disasters that have adversely affected its tourism-driven economy. Stakeholders in the tourism sector are advocating for a comprehensive strategy that includes tourism, agriculture, and infrastructure development to revitalize the local economy.
As the Kerala Assembly elections approach, candidates are being urged to present clear visions for enhancing tourism and addressing the needs of the local community. Initiatives such as disaster tourism and improved infrastructure are being proposed to attract visitors and sustain economic growth.
The LDF candidate from Kalapetta highlights the necessity of developing major tourism centers and innovative projects to draw visitors. Voter sentiment is increasingly focused on candidates' plans for the future of tourism in the district, with the election set for April 9.

Wayanad's tourism sector is facing challenges due to natural disasters that have impacted the local economy. Stakeholders are advocating for a comprehensive plan to enhance tourism, agriculture, and infrastructure in the region.
- Wayanads tourism sector is struggling due to natural disasters that have harmed the local economy. Stakeholders are calling for a comprehensive plan focusing on tourism, agriculture, and infrastructure to rejuvenate the area
- Social workers stress the need for candidates to articulate a clear vision for the districts growth. They advocate for initiatives that blend the regions natural beauty with tourism, including innovative ideas like disaster tourism
- Improving basic infrastructure in Wayanad is crucial, as recent state-funded projects indicate growth potential. Future leaders should leverage this momentum with effective marketing to position Wayanad as a key tourism destination
- Concerns about human-animal conflicts are noted, but they may not significantly deter tourism. This underscores the need to explore new tourist attractions and ease travel restrictions to improve visitor experiences
- Implementing online booking systems and lifting night travel bans are essential for tourism recovery. These actions could enhance accessibility and draw more visitors to the region
- The local community is urging immediate action to prioritize tourism and infrastructure development. The results of the upcoming elections could greatly impact the future of Wayanads tourism industry
